Program Purpose:

The goal of this Engage project is to facilitate the design and production of novel polystyrenes for chemical andx000D
industrial applications of our partner, Enerkem. The Enerkem uses highly selective catalysts to formx000D
oxygenated compounds by CO hydrogenation and by ethylene hydroformylation over catalysts under highx000D
pressure. Modifications of the Rh/SiO2 catalyst, including its size, have a great influence on CO hydrogenationx000D
at high pressure. The high performance of the heterogenous catalysts has been attributed to a combination of ax000D
high ligand concentration and a flexible polymer framework. The objective of the project is to determine thex000D
properties of several Rh catalysts, including their surface size, morphology, as well as their oxidation state.x000D
This collaboration will lead to the manufacturing and development of more appropriate products for futurex000D
markets.
